Slipstream confirms Millar, Zabriskie, and Vande Velde
Source: cyclingnews.com
July 31, 2007 – Jonathan Vaughters has confirmed three new signings to his Team Slipstream squad for 2008, including the widely rumoured move of Briton David Millar. The American, who has set his sights on taking Slipstream to the Tour de France in 2008, has been courting some high profile riders for his ‘08 [...]

Big weekend wraps up for Team Slipstream-Chipotle
July 30, 2007 – Team Slipstream wraped up an extemely successful week of racing at the tour de toona winning the team general classification, the best young rider (Peter Stetina), most aggressive rider (Mike Friedman), and two stage wins (Friedman and Taylor Tolleson). Team Director Allen Lim felt great about the team’s efforts noting that [...]
Tolleson wins stage 6 at Tour de Toona!
July 30, 2007 – Altoona, PA – It was another great day for the team today in Altoona, PA as Taylor Tolleson pulled off one of his biggest wins to date by winning the longest and hardest stage of the Tour de Toona.
Sprinting from an emaciated field, Taylor came across the line first, surprising second [...]
